Market Sizing, Growth Estimates, and CAGR Projections

Based on current industry data, the South Korea PC Perfluoro Flame Retardants market was valued at approximately USD 150 million

in 2023. The market is projected to grow at a compound annual growth rate (CAGR) of around 6.5%

over the next five years, reaching an estimated USD 220 million

by 2028. This growth trajectory assumes moderate expansion in the electronics, automotive, and construction sectors, coupled with increasing regulatory pressures on flame retardant standards.

Key assumptions underpinning these estimates include:

  • Continued expansion of electronics manufacturing, especially in consumer devices and automotive electronics.
  • Gradual adoption of environmentally compliant PFRs driven by evolving regulations.
  • Steady growth in the construction industry, particularly in high-rise and infrastructure projects requiring flame-retardant materials.
  • Technological advancements reducing costs and improving performance of PFRs.

Value Chain & Revenue Models

The value chain begins with raw material sourcing, where fluorinated chemicals are procured from global suppliers. These materials undergo chemical processing and formulation to produce flame-retardant PC resins, which are then integrated into end-use products. Distribution channels include direct sales to OEMs, specialty distributors, and licensing arrangements for proprietary formulations.

Revenue models are primarily based on:

  • Product sales (per kilogram or metric ton basis)
  • Licensing fees for proprietary formulations and technology platforms
  • Lifecycle services including technical support, certification assistance, and post-sale maintenance

The lifecycle of PFR-enhanced PC products involves ongoing compliance updates, performance optimization, and recycling initiatives, which influence long-term revenue streams and customer loyalty.

Cost Structures, Pricing, and Investment Patterns

Cost structures are heavily influenced by raw material prices, R&D investments, and regulatory compliance costs. Raw materials constitute approximately 40–50% of production costs, with fluctuations driven by global fluorochemical markets.

Pricing strategies are shifting toward value-based models, emphasizing performance and compliance rather than solely cost. Premium pricing is justified for high-performance, environmentally compliant PFRs.

Capital investments are focused on advanced manufacturing facilities, R&D centers, and digital infrastructure. Operating margins for leading players are typically in the 12–18% range, with higher margins achievable through innovation and market differentiation.

Adoption Trends & End-User Insights

Electronics & Electrical Equipment

  • High adoption of flame-retardant PC in smartphones, laptops, and 5G infrastructure due to safety standards.
  • Use cases include enclosures, connectors, and circuit boards.

Automotive & Transportation

  • Increased use in EV battery housings, interior components, and wiring harnesses.
  • Shift toward lightweight, fire-safe plastics to meet safety and efficiency standards.

Construction & Infrastructure

  • Demand driven by fire safety codes in high-rise buildings, public transit, and infrastructure projects.
  • Application in glazing, roofing, and interior panels.
